Win10PHP7如何优化MySQL,让你的网站速度提升数倍
作为一个网站管理员,你一定希望你的网站能够快速响应用户的请求,让用户留下良好的印象。而MySQL数据库是网站中最重要的组成部分之一,优化MySQL数据库是提高网站性能的关键之一。在本文中,我们将介绍如何通过优化MySQL数据库来提高网站的速度。
第一步:选择正确的引擎
noDB引擎是一个不错的选择,因为它支持事务和行级锁定,可以提高并发性能。而对于小型网站,MyISAM引擎可能更适合,因为它对读操作的支持更好。
第二步:优化查询语句
查询语句是MySQL数据库中最常用的操作之一,优化查询语句可以显著提高数据库性能。可以通过以下方式来优化查询语句:
1.使用索引:索引可以加快查询速度,对于经常被查询的列,可以添加索引。
2.避免使用SELECT *:只查询需要的列可以减少查询时间,因为不需要读取所有的列。
3.避免使用子查询:子查询会增加查询时间,尽量避免使用。
第三步:优化表结构
优化表结构也是提高MySQL数据库性能的重要一步。可以通过以下方式来优化表结构:
1.使用正确的数据类型:选择正确的数据类型可以减少存储空间和提高查询速度。
2.避免使用NULL:NULL值会占用额外的存储空间,尽量避免使用。
3.使用自增主键:使用自增主键可以提高插入速度。
第四步:调整服务器参数
调整服务器参数也可以提高MySQL数据库性能。可以通过以下方式来调整服务器参数:
1.增加内存:增加服务器内存可以提高数据库缓存,提高查询速度。
2.调整缓存大小:调整缓存大小可以提高查询速度。
3.调整线程池大小:调整线程池大小可以提高并发性能。
通过本文,我们介绍了如何通过优化MySQL数据库来提高网站性能。可以选择正确的存储引擎、优化查询语句、优化表结构和调整服务器参数来提高性能。
声明:本文内容由网友自发贡献,本站不承担相应法律责任。对本内容有异议或投诉,请联系2913721942#qq.com核实处理,我们将尽快回复您,谢谢合作!
若转载请注明出处: Win10PHP7如何优化MySQL,让你的网站速度提升数倍
本文地址: https://pptw.com/jishu/309720.html